A warm welcome awaits in our converted farm granary, set in quiet relaxing gardens. Farm walks, games room for rainy days. Ideal for families and couples. Good touring base for South Shropshire and North Herefordshire.
We are 4 miles from the market town of Leominster, renowned for its antique shops and a historic wool town and 6 miles from Ludlow home of 'Slow Food' and its many festivals including the Food Festival, Medieval Fayre and Shakespeare open air theatre around the Castle. We are a short drive to the Cathedral city of Hereford.
The National Trust properties of Berrington Hall come and enjoy the cider apple festival and Croft Castle for battle re-enactments, etc. are on the doorstep, and close to the 'Black and White Trail'
Ashton has been farmed by the Edwards family since 1937 when Bill's family came as tenant farmers to the Berrington Hall Estate. In the 1970's Bill bought the farm from the Cawley's, giving up half his acreage. Bill & Pam decided to convert the farm buildings into accommodation for their son and daughter, and cater for holiday cottages. The land is let as grass keep for sheep.
East Cottage is converted from a half timbered granary and has been fully updated in 2010, with garages underneath, approached by a short flight of steps. Traditional country living in a relaxing, comfortable farmhouse environment sleeping approx 5 people.
